Navigating U.S.-Mexico Relations

This chapter examines how American politics shape Mexico's domestic policies, with a focus on security and drug trafficking under the leadership of Claudia Sheinbaum. It highlights the intricate balance between external pressures from the U.S. and Mexico's strategic responses, including reforms aimed at economic sustainability and enhanced security measures.
